技术文摘
借助Java编写的ORM框架简化MySQL数据库操作
在当今的软件开发领域,数据库操作是众多项目中不可或缺的一部分。MySQL作为一款广泛使用的关系型数据库,其操作的复杂性常常给开发者带来挑战。而借助Java编写的ORM框架,能够极大地简化MySQL数据库操作流程,提高开发效率。
ORM(Object Relational Mapping)框架的核心原理是在对象和关系型数据库之间建立一种映射关系。通过这种映射,开发者可以使用面向对象的方式来操作数据库,而无需编写复杂的SQL语句。在Java环境中,有许多优秀的ORM框架,如Hibernate、MyBatis等。
以Hibernate为例,它提供了丰富的API来处理数据库事务、对象持久化等操作。在使用Hibernate时,开发者首先需要定义持久化类,这些类与数据库中的表相对应。通过配置文件或注解,将类的属性映射到表的列上。这样,当需要进行数据库操作时,只需要操作这些持久化类的对象即可。例如,保存一个对象,只需调用Hibernate的save方法,框架会自动生成相应的SQL INSERT语句并执行。
MyBatis也是一款受欢迎的ORM框架,它更加灵活,允许开发者在XML文件中编写SQL语句,然后通过映射关系将参数传递给SQL语句,并处理返回结果。这种方式在需要编写复杂SQL查询时非常实用,开发者可以根据具体需求定制SQL语句,同时又能享受ORM框架带来的面向对象编程的便利。
借助Java编写的ORM框架简化MySQL数据库操作,不仅提高了代码的可读性和可维护性,还降低了开发成本。对于新手开发者来说,ORM框架提供了更友好的开发方式,减少了对复杂SQL语句的依赖。对于有经验的开发者,能够将更多的精力放在业务逻辑的实现上,而不是花费大量时间在数据库操作的细节上。ORM框架在Java与MySQL的结合中发挥着重要作用,是现代软件开发中值得广泛应用的技术。
TAGS: ORM技术 MySQL数据库操作 Java ORM框架 简化数据库操作
- Tomcat 4.0与Tomcat 4.1中JSP页面中文问题的解答
- Eclipse插件开发下的刷新与重编译实现
- 提升JSP操作中的数据库访问效率
- Java开发常见异常问题
- 几种可能引发性能问题的代码写法汇总
- JSP教程基础:JSP2.0特性讲解
- JSP环境下Apache2.2与Tomcat5.5的整合配置
- Java之父力挺Java应用商店 称可击败苹果
- Hibernate事务中事务对象的方法
- Hibernate中Criteria的基本查询
- Hibernate Criteria进阶查询技巧
- Hibernate中Criteria查询实例的使用
- 在Hibernate中运用DetchedCriteria
- JSP编程安全实例浅析
- JSP教程:访问量计数JSP源码